North West Plaza is a combination of 42,700 square-foot retail shopping center and pad sites, situated in the west-end of York, PA along Route 30 (43,000 CPD) and situated between Roosevelt Avenue & Interstate 83. The center is connected to the neighboring shopping center, Two Guys Commons, which is anchored by ALDI, Crunch Fitness, Tractor Supply, and Octapharma. North West Plaza is 100% percent occupied by a mix of national, regional, and local Tenants, such as; Denny’s, Monro Muffler, Fujihana, Trust Cleaners, The Lube Center, and Kabinet King, just to name a few.
Along with its great visibility and access to Route 30, this site benefits from a demographic area that includes top manufacturers in York County such as Target, Starbucks, Harley Davidson and Johnson Controls, all with substantial distribution centers along I-83 just a few short miles away, as well as UPMC Pinnacle Memorial Hospital’s new 220,000 square foot replacement hospital, which is less than one mile away from North West Plaza and opened in August 2019.
Adding to the stability of the project, North West Plaza shows a 20-minute drive time demographic of over 336,646 people with household incomes of more than $75,123 and daytime employment demographics equally as strong with 161,342. The demographics within a 10-mile radius include 266,196 people in 105,144 homes, a labor force of 140,451 with an average household income of $74,563. The area’s growth since 2000 has increased over 15.6% with over 16,502 new homes.

A property’s location contributes to the asking rent almost as much as its characteristics do. For instance, central urban locations with high walkability or suburban locations with ample parking and easy access by car will claim higher rents but offer superior access to your customer base. Likewise, the quality of the building systems and property finishes have a significant impact on how businesses can conduct their activity there, as well as on the experience of their customers.
Retail space at North West Plaza asks $24.00/SF/YR per square foot.
-
The property includes 4,000 square feet of retail space for lease. Of this total, 4,000 square feet are Retail.
Lease agreement conditions for the availability at this property include NNN.
